About This Item
T. Werner Laurie, 1926. First 1 volume edition. 8 coloured plates and other illustrations. 8vo (10 1/4 x 6 1/2 inches), 400-pages. Original blue cloth gilt. Spine dulled, half inch split to lower joint, partly crossed through inscription on recto of frontispiece; overall good.
